Tools

Definition of a tool: “A muscle-powered device that solves a problem by providing a mechanical advantage in order to do useful work.”

Examples of tools include hammer, screwdriver, tape measure, drill, saw, and wrenches.

Fasteners

Definition of Fasteners: “Devices used to join or assemble parts together.”

Examples of fasteners include nails, screws, nuts and bolts, hooks, and pins.

Hammer

Hammers are used as levers. They can bang in nails with the head end or remove nails using the claw end.

Fasteners- Nails

• Common fastener for wood

• A fast and strong method for joining wood.

• Used in building houses

Fastener- Screws

• Slotted screws and crosshead screws

• Put into material with a screwdriver that matches the screw head

• Screws pull together things to be joined

• Screws can be screwed into wood, metal, or plastic

• Stronger connection than nails

Fasteners- Nuts and Bolts

• Holes must be drilled first in each item

• Bolt is passed through both holes

• Nut is then threaded onto bolt and tightened

• A wrench tightens everything.

• Strongest connection
